WHEDA CEO Altoro Has Accepted Position in Biden Administration
WHEDA Executive Director and CEO Joaquín Altoro has accepted a position in the Biden Administration. This week Altoro was sworn in as the Administrator of Rural Housing Service within the U.S. Department of Agriculture Rural Development. “We are appreciative of Joaquín Altoro’s strategic vision and leadership to help WHEDA advance affordable housing in our rural and urban communities,” said Kim Plache, WHEDA Deputy Executive Director. “And we celebrate his new role at the federal level where he will continue to be an advocate for greater equity in housing and economic opportunity.”

Florida Housing Finance Corporation Honors Military Personnel Through Salute Our Soldiers Program
The Florida Housing Finance Corporation (Florida Housing) launched the Salute Our Soldiers Military Loan Program in 2020 to assist Florida’s growing population of veteran and active-duty military personnel in obtaining permanent housing. The Salute Our Soldiers program offers a variety of down payment and closing cost assistance (DPA), coupled with low interest rate first mortgage loans. Some of the DPA products offered are even forgivable after five years.

CHFA Announces 2021 Round Two Housing Tax Credit Awards
Colorado Housing and Finance Authority (CHFA) is pleased to announce 14 developments will be awarded a reservation of federal and state Housing Tax Credits to support the new construction or preservation of 1,373 affordable apartments. These developments will seek to address various housing needs in Colorado, supporting individuals, families, homeless households, individuals ages 18-24 aging out of foster care, and adults ages 55 or older, and 62 or older.
CDFA Report Finds PAB Issuance at Record Highs for 2019 and 2020; Housing Bond Issuance Increases
Private activity bond (PAB) issuance reached record-high levels in 2019 before declining slightly in 2020, according to the Council of Development Finance Agencies’ (CDFA) Annual Volume Cap Report for 2019 and 2020. The report, released late last week, presents data on how states allocate and use their PAB cap each year. This report covers 2019 and 2020; CDFA did not conduct its annual survey in 2019 due to the COVID-19 pandemic. As in the previous five years, Housing Bonds, including single-family Mortgage Revenue Bonds (MRBs) and multifamily bonds, made up the bulk of PAB issuance in 2019 and 2020.
The Connecticut Housing Finance Authority Appoints Lisa G. Hensley as Managing Director of Homeownership Programs
The Connecticut Housing Finance Authority (CHFA) has appointed Lisa G. Hensely to lead the Authority’s Homeownership Department. Ms. Hensley, formerly Senior Vice President of Single-family Programs of the District of Columbia Housing Finance Authority joined CHFA on November 1. Hensley will be responsible for strategic oversight and management of the Authority’s homeownership business lines, driving product and business development to increase the number of state residents who have access to affordable mortgage financing through CHFA.

Financing for 3 New Multi-Family Affordable Housing Developments Approved by NH Housing Board
Funding for three affordable multi-family housing developments was approved by the New Hampshire Housing Board of Directors at its October meeting. These 83 new units will help meet the critical need for affordable rental housing for our state’s workforce and other residents. The allocation of Low-Income Housing Tax Credits (LIHTC) and other federal and state funding to these projects will produce new affordable rental housing in Concord, Newport, and Rochester. New Hampshire Housing anticipates approving LIHTC allocations for additional developments later this year.
